In a nutshell

We’ll be staying at a beautiful 4-star hotel, perfectly placed for both relaxation and island adventures. Spending our days enjoying some much deserved downtime. 

 

When we’re ready to explore, we’ll wander the historic streets of Valletta, soaking up its baroque architecture, lively waterfront, and charming cafés. Then it’s off on a boat trip to the crystal-clear waters of the Blue Lagoon and the neighbouring island of Gozo, where we can swim or just take in the stunning coastal scenery. Between activities, there’ll be plenty of time to slow down, enjoy the sunshine, and savour the relaxed pace of island life.
